Rock Drills: Powering Through Excavation

Rock drills pulverize their way through the toughest terrain, providing a vital tool for construction, mining, and infrastructure development. These powerful machines utilize high-impact rotations or percussion forces to break down rock and sediment, enabling the creation of tunnels, foundations, and other excavations. From compact handheld drills employed in smaller tasks to massive industrial rigs capable of penetrating bedrock with ease, rock drills are indispensable for completing large-scale earthmoving projects.

  • Modern rock drills often incorporate advanced features such as dust suppression systems and automated drilling cycles to enhance operator comfort and efficiency.
  • The choice of drill type depends on the specific application, with factors like rock hardness, depth of excavation, and environmental considerations all playing a role.

With their unmatched power and versatility, rock drills continue to revolutionize the world of excavation, opening up new possibilities for infrastructure development and resource extraction.

Choosing the Right Rock Drill Equipment

When it comes to mineral extraction, having the correct drill equipment is paramount. A poorly selected drill can lead to poor performance and even hazard. Therefore, evaluating your specific requirements is crucial before making a purchase. Consider factors like the type of material you're drilling, the depth of your project, and your financial constraints.

  • Examining different drill types available on the scene is essential. There are a number of options, including rotary drills, hammer drills, and DTH drills, each with its own advantages and limitations.
  • Consulting experienced drill operators or professionals can provide valuable insights. They can help you select the most appropriate drill for your situation.

Committing in a high-quality drill that meets your demands is an resource that will pay off in the long run. By choosing the right rock drill machinery, you can enhance your mining productivity and ensure a safe and successful operation.

Diagnose Like a Pro: Common Rock Drill Spare Part Issues

Rock drills are powerful tools used in various construction and demolition applications. Yet, these robust machines can occasionally encounter problems rock drill spare parts cost due to wear and tear on their spare parts. Identifying the source of the issue is crucial for effective repair.

Here are some common rock drill spare part problems and troubleshooting tips:

  • Damaged Chisel Bits:
  • Chisel bits are subject to significant stress during drilling operations, leading to wear. Inspect the chisel bit regularly for signs of chipping, cracking, or dullness. Replace it if necessary to ensure optimal performance and safety.

  • Faulty Motor:** The motor is the heart of a rock drill, providing the power required for drilling. A defective motor can result in reduced drilling speed or complete failure. Check the motor's wires for damage and ensure proper voltage supply.

  • Overtightened Air Fittings:
  • Air leaks can significantly impact drilling efficiency and safety. Inspect air fittings for looseness, overtightening, or stripping. Tighten loose connections and replace damaged fittings to create a secure seal.

  • Blocked Air Filter:
  • A clogged air filter can restrict airflow to the motor, causing overheating and efficiency issues. Regularly clean or replace the air filter to maintain optimal airflow.

Remember, regular maintenance and inspection are key to preventing major rock drill problems.
